diff --git a/src/events/message.js b/src/events/message.js index 3505c1c..8904399 100644 --- a/src/events/message.js +++ b/src/events/message.js @@ -152,7 +152,7 @@ module.exports = async (client, message) => { .then(m => m.delete(2000)); }; - if (!perms.has('SEND_MESSAGES')) { + if (message.guild && !perms.has('SEND_MESSAGES')) { return message.author.send(`<:error:466995152976871434> I don't have permission to speak in **#${message.channel.name}**, Please ask a moderator to give me the send messages permission!`); }; @@ -224,4 +224,4 @@ module.exports = async (client, message) => { client.logger.cmd(`${client.config.permLevels.find(l => l.level === level).name} ${message.author.username} (${message.author.id}) ran command ${cmd.help.name}`); cmd.run(client, message, args, level); -}; \ No newline at end of file +};